Transaction 631573e08c4138a187e94695d9ab84987963e0de33f4a75a9d189aa1e3bfd64c
1 Input
1 Output
-
631573e08c4138a187e94695d9ab84987963e0de33f4a75a9d189aa1e3bfd64c:0
- value
- 1175342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f81e520a3f4e4549748113d7e5c3546cfdd11190 OP_EQUAL
- address
- 3QJwppZT26eQr9puxYVF5HZjMuBCiPhCNf